4. | Stephen Nowlin (2.Sarah2, 1.John1) was born 1708, Colonial Virginia; died 1791, Goochland County, Virginia; was buried , Beaverdam Episcopal Church Cem., Maidens, Goochland Co., Virginia. Notes:
Will of James Nowlin; Son, Stephen Nowlin one hundred and fifty acres of Land, be the same more or less and bounded as followeth, beginning on the North side of Busselon Cranch at a Corner white oak thence up the said branch to William Gay's line, thence Northwardly and along the said Ray's line to Col. Bollings line to a White Oake to corner, thence Southwardly to a corner Red Oak to corner thence southwestwardly to same Corner Tree began at, to him forever.

8. | John Nowlin (2.Sarah2, 1.John1) was born Abt 1718, Goochland, Virginia Colony; died Yes, date unknown. Notes:
Will of James Nowlin; I give and bequeath unto my son, John Nowlin the Mansion Plantation I now live on for two hundred acres of land be same more or less of being bounded as followeths, between Stephen Nowlin and Thomas Pleasants of Col. John Bolling lines forever. But if in case ye above said, John Nowlin should die without ishew of his body lawfully begotten my desire is that my son, David Nowlin's son, Samuel shall have the same land above mentioned to John Nowlin forever.
I likewise give and bequeath unto my son John one feather bed and furnature to wit and ....

14. | Bryan Ward aka James Nowlin (3.James3, 2.Sarah2, 1.John1) was born 8 Oct 1740, Boone, Virginia; died 1810, Pittsylvania County, Virginia . Notes:
Served as Private in Illinois Campaign under Capt. Bowman.
Place of residence Chatham, VA. Listed on DAR Patriotic
Index page 500 for Patriotic Service. Also listed in the
Military record page 262 Missouri Pioneers. [Our Families,
Anna Hudelson; page 1]
The Assembly of Pittsylvania Co. VA ordered that all male
inhabitants sixteen years of age and over should take the
Oath of Allegiance to the State. Bryan Ward Nowlin is
listed as subscribing before William Witcher in
Pittsylvania County, VA. [Our Families, Anna Hudelson; page
1]
Was a builder by trade. Had 15 children.
